Vuelta a Chihuahua stage 7: Circuito Chihuahua

The final stage of the Vuelta a Chihuahua is one for the spectators. The 14-lap circuit race is 84 km long and runs through the streets of Chihuahua. Today’s stages starts at 9:00 and will finish between 10:49-11:00.

Vuelta a Chihuahua stage 4 ITT: Pitorreal>Divisadero

Today’s sharply rolling 18.9 km individual time trial along the Sierra Tarahumara range will test the riders’ already weary legs. The first rider starts at 12:00 and the last rider is expected to finish between 14:35 and 14:51.

Vuelta a Chihuahua stage 3: Guachochi>Creel

As the ultimate mountain day, stage 3 of the Vuelta a Chihuahua will surely prove decisive. It is 155.9 km long and includes seven mountain points lines, finishing on high in Creel at 2,491 meters altitude. Today’s stages starts at 12:00 and will finish between 16:09-16:40.

Chihuahua stage 2 *very* brief report
Short post-race summary from DS Johnny Weltz Today was good for us. Pat was in a long breakaway and took the mountain jersey. Tom Peterson was 4th on the stage (unofficially) and would normally take over the Best Young Rider classification. Please stay tuned for a full report, results and photos!
Vuelta a Chihuahua stage 2: Parral>Guachochi

Stage 2 of the Vuelta a Chihuahua is 188.7 km long and includes no less than five mountain points lines as it crosses the Sierra Tarahumara mountain range. Today’s stages starts at 10:00 and will finish between 15:15-15:52.

Vuelta a Chihuahua stage 1: Chihuahua>Camargo

The opening stage of the 2008 Vuelta a Chihuahua is 147.8 km long and includes one mountain and three intermediate sprint lines. The organizers are predicting that this flat stage will be fast and furious, with average speeds up to 48 kph. Stage 1 starts at 10:05 am and will finish between 13:23-13:45.
